5.1 Size Selection
1) Measure the circumference of the thigh 15 cm above the centre of the
patella.
2) Measure the circumference of the lower leg 15 cm below the centre of
the patella.
3) Determine the size of the orthosis (see size chart).
5.2 Application
CAUTION
Incorrect or excessively tight application
Risk of local pressure and constriction of blood vessels and nerves due to
improper or excessively tight application
► Ensure that the orthosis is applied properly and fits correctly.
Prerequisite: The patient should be seated.
>
Prerequisite: The knee joint should be relieved of pressure and slightly
>
bent.
1) Open all hook-and-loop closures.
2) Grasp the orthosis by the donning loops (see fig. 1, item 1) and pull it
over the foot up to the knee with the large opening first (see fig. 2).
3) Adjust the orthosis until the patella is positioned in the centre of the
patella cutout (see fig. 3) and the orthotic joint is at the height of the
middle of the patella.
4) Guide the lower leg strap through the strap guide loop, pull it taut and
close it at the hook-and-loop closure (see fig. 4).
5) Guide the thigh strap through the strap guide loop, pull it taut and close
it at the hook-and-loop closure (see fig. 5).
6) Ensure that the orthosis is in the correct position.
7) Optional: Adjust the corrective force; this changes the varus/valgus
angle of the orthosis (see fig. 6).
